Full Analysis
  • [PROMPT_INJECTION]: The skill instructions explicitly command the agent to bypass standard user confirmation and approval workflows for dependency installation. Evidence includes phrases such as "automatically without asking the user to confirm" and "do not request separate approval for dependency installation."
  • [PROMPT_INJECTION]: The instructions include concealment tactics, directing the agent not to describe the installation process to the user and to avoid requesting approval, which reduces user oversight and suppresses transparency.
  • [EXTERNAL_DOWNLOADS]: The skill references an external URL (https://www.browseract.com/...) and instructs the agent to use it for automatic installation of missing components. This represents a download from an unverified source.
  • [REMOTE_CODE_EXECUTION]: By instructing the agent to fetch and install dependencies from an external link without user intervention, the skill creates a pathway for executing unverified code within the agent's environment.
  • [DATA_EXFILTRATION]: While not directly exfiltrating data, the skill processes potentially sensitive search results (keywords, profile data, URLs) using an external browser automation tool, which could expose that data to the third-party service.
